Caring for a spouse, parent or grandparent with Parkinson’s at home and maintaining your aging loved one’s quality of life will present a different set of challenges with each disease stage. Early Parkinson’s typically requires less hands-on care but that likely will change as Parkinson’s disease progresses into more critical symptoms like tremors, walking or balance difficulties, rigidity or stiffness, and slow movement or loss of movement, along with increased difficulty in swallowing, speaking and understanding. Parkinson’s In-Home Care Services

Amada caregivers are trained on how to assist a senior Parkinson’s client in managing PD symptoms in ways that can positively impact the individual’s well-being and quality of life. Our trained Amada caregivers serve families in Douglas, Sarpy, Cass, Saunders and Lancaster counties all the way to Council Bluffs, Iowa, and understand that in-home care for Parkinson’s clients requires all of the following and more:

  • Offer patience and empathy while assisting senior Parkinson’s clients with activities of daily living, while still allowing the senior to do as much as possible.
  • Encourage communication, ambulation, social activities and social involvement as much as possible while the senior PD client can still participate and be involved.
  • Help to make the PD client’s home environment safe by keeping pathways open, clearing obstacles and removing floor rugs or unsteady decor.
  • Serve as a member of the Parkinson’s home care team by observing symptoms, giving medication reminders, following the PD client’s dietary plan as prescribed by a physician, and assisting with performing the physical therapist and occupational therapist’s exercises.
